Chip123 科技應用創新平台

 找回密碼
 申請會員

QQ登錄

只需一步,快速開始

Login

用FB帳號登入

搜索
1 2 3 4
查看: 6144|回復: 9
打印 上一主題 下一主題

[問題求助] 訊號極性的判斷

[複製鏈接]
跳轉到指定樓層
1#
發表於 2007-6-29 16:52:44 | 只看該作者 回帖獎勵 |倒序瀏覽 |閱讀模式
各位大大...
: s" x1 M! u. G6 w  }2 [) t3 h我又來煩大家了..
* w# J  p9 u$ f2 f# D7 A這次想問大家對於訊號極性都是如何去判斷的....
1 m3 \5 l$ z8 s7 L譬如...V-sync是atcive positive or negative如何去偵測...
分享到:  QQ好友和群QQ好友和群 QQ空間QQ空間 騰訊微博騰訊微博 騰訊朋友騰訊朋友
收藏收藏 分享分享 頂 踩 分享分享
2#
發表於 2007-7-2 14:16:04 | 只看該作者
根據信號的timing spec
3#
 樓主| 發表於 2007-7-3 22:06:16 | 只看該作者
我想要自動可以去判斷訊號的極性..9 H4 B, r$ o7 D: I
而不是看timming spec
( }  y# F! h4 F. f) E我現在的寫法是去算訊號high的時間..
! i* F0 o! K) @+ q5 @5 W超過某一個值...就判斷是 負極性...& q; \, m! D" V% A
不知道還有沒有其他的方法
4#
發表於 2007-7-4 20:11:28 | 只看該作者
你在做VGA信號嗎?; g* ~+ \; N1 w9 y7 A  x
8 B* e, l4 }- C6 P
是的話也許有更容易的方法
5#
 樓主| 發表於 2007-7-5 19:46:57 | 只看該作者
原帖由 tommywgt 於 2007-7-4 08:11 PM 發表 ' L/ f, n' _0 c) {
你在做VGA信號嗎?9 _' ~: s8 c9 Y( K
1 |4 p& ^( s; v# B" I& L
是的話也許有更容易的方法

; G' A5 I4 z& w. `9 j6 h4 o4 Z( B# q5 c' ]2 c
9 G8 N& |$ B+ u- }7 H
我要偵測vga的信號....: B- k( L0 ^" P6 |) e0 F; Y
所以要先判斷訊號的極性
6#
發表於 2007-7-8 00:40:26 | 只看該作者
一般是先判斷信號的timing 後去查VESA SPEC找出類似的timing,# q' E$ b: N$ d  [5 ]
找的到的話就是那一組信號, 找不到時再以內定值去判斷, 不是嗎?
7#
 樓主| 發表於 2007-7-9 20:41:57 | 只看該作者
原帖由 tommywgt 於 2007-7-8 12:40 AM 發表
7 ~1 j5 g9 B3 M2 V& J一般是先判斷信號的timing 後去查VESA SPEC找出類似的timing,
; c# \( y6 F1 r- F( J4 m9 m找的到的話就是那一組信號, 找不到時再以內定值去判斷, 不是嗎?

$ J6 W! f/ Q9 |6 l' c6 N
4 Y% U( {9 n8 M/ V那是scaler的寫法....+ u% L5 U' L( b1 b" A% Y
用timming table直接找...不過在vesa spec裡有二個timming都一樣
" S  _: u6 c) l& c& z: z只有極性不一樣...所以極性還是要判5 N! q2 i* K$ }4 {/ d

$ o, ~% c9 h+ p# q; W$ Z6 _0 c而我只是要偵測訊號的極性而已...3 [. e" `7 h$ l- m- `8 \
不需要知道是什麼timming..
8#
發表於 2007-7-10 17:17:20 | 只看該作者
嗯...
+ o/ N4 l4 W  f: `那再換個方式/ m$ L7 Y* m  [5 c1 p& Q
一般而言, sync的信號的pluse比較窄, 判斷信號的duty cycle的話ok嗎?
9#
 樓主| 發表於 2007-7-10 21:11:05 | 只看該作者
原帖由 tommywgt 於 2007-7-10 05:17 PM 發表 # v) j3 n/ m7 x( {8 s
嗯...
: K- ]- Y! ]3 \% }; D那再換個方式7 e) h; Q/ v( d; H# f3 V2 I' u& i
一般而言, sync的信號的pluse比較窄, 判斷信號的duty cycle的話ok嗎?
5 I* ]4 p  A7 P
7 p( J; q' Q6 N
& Q( K6 W- }  @" r" ~5 L

7 K, o/ v$ x3 L. P4 D0 m1 d我現在就是用這種方法...& |. ^# e, }; E" t4 j

, u0 Z: p1 O9 B4 j2 A2 w用CLK去count訊號...
& a; e2 h& N9 Q+ ?/ L& `5 M6 S如果count high的時間超過某一個值..
' D; }8 R: K, s$ k+ a那此訊號就當做是negedge 否則就是positive
10#
發表於 2007-7-10 22:29:23 | 只看該作者
說真的 當初我看到你問的問題真的是蠻無釐頭的
* |8 T  Y/ M0 c) I  t7 s$ o- V9 u, S& o3 ^9 i& Y
與其說是訊號的極性不如說是訊號的動作準位(Active High or Active Low)
您需要登錄後才可以回帖 登錄 | 申請會員

本版積分規則

首頁|手機版|Chip123 科技應用創新平台 |新契機國際商機整合股份有限公司

GMT+8, 2024-6-4 10:01 PM , Processed in 0.123015 second(s), 18 queries .

Powered by Discuz! X3.2

© 2001-2013 Comsenz Inc.

快速回復 返回頂部 返回列表